Picking the Perfect End Mill Tool
Achieving optimal results when machining materials relies heavily on selecting the appropriate end mill tool. Numerous factors influence this crucial decision, including the properties of the workpiece material, desired shape, and operational requirements. Understanding these elements is key for enhancing cutting performance, tool life, and overall quality.
When evaluating end mill options, it's vital to review the material being worked. Tough materials often require tools with stronger substrates and coatings to withstand abrasion and wear. Conversely, softer materials may benefit from sharper cutting edges for smoother finishes.
- Moreover, the desired finish plays a significant role in end mill pick. For intricate designs, a small-diameter end mill with a high helix angle is often preferred. Larger diameter tools, on the other hand, are better suited for shaving larger amounts of material efficiently.
- Machining speeds and feed rates also influence end mill selection. High-speed machining often requires tools with durable geometries and coatings to maintain stability and accuracy at elevated velocities.
In conclusion, selecting the right end mill tool is a multifaceted process that 2 end mill requires careful analysis of various factors. By understanding these elements, machinists can optimize their cutting performance, tool life, and overall efficiency.
